Component ID Optical Discs Software on optical discs, such as CDs or DVDs, is included with all notebook models. ■ The software packaged in the "Required for Setup" bag is not preinstalled on your notebook. Depending on how you want to use your notebook, you may want to install some or all of these applications. ■ The software packaged in the "Save for Later" bag is preinstalled or preloaded on your notebook. The software discs are provided in case you ever need to repair or reinstall this software. Labels The labels affixed to the notebook provide information you may need when you troubleshoot system problems or travel internationally with the notebook. ■ Service Tag-Provides the product name, product number (P/N), and serial number (S/N) of your notebook. You may need the product number and the serial number when you contact Customer Care. The Service Tag label is affixed to the bottom of the notebook. To display the information on the Service Tag on your screen, select Start > Help and Support. ■ Microsoft Certificate of Authenticity-Contains the Microsoft® Windows® Product Key. You may need the Product Key to update or troubleshoot the operating system. This certificate is affixed to the bottom of the notebook. ■ Regulatory label-Provides regulatory information about the notebook. The Regulatory label is affixed to the inside of the battery bay.
